Hotel Description

Nestled in the charming seaside town of Cuxhaven, Hotel Beckröge offers a perfect retreat for those seeking both relaxation and adventure. Located at 9-11, Dohrmannstraße, 27472 Cuxhaven, Germany, this delightful hotel occupies a stately 19th-century villa just a short 5-minute walk from the serene Elbe River. Guests will appreciate the hotel’s proximity to key attractions, including the iconic Kugelbake beacon, only 2 kilometers away, and the fascinating Joachim Ringelnatz Museum. This welcoming hotel exudes an inviting atmosphere, blending historical architecture with modern comfort, making it an ideal choice for travelers looking to immerse themselves in Cuxhaven's rich maritime history. The hotel is within easy reach of the picturesque Kurpark Zoo, as well as a variety of restaurants lining the beach promenade, perfect for those wanting to experience the local culture and flavors. The rooms at Hotel Beckröge are designed with comfort in mind, providing a relaxing space after a day of exploring the surrounding area. With 11 cozy rooms, each equipped with flat-screen TVs and Wi-Fi access (for a small fee), guests can enjoy a restful stay in a peaceful, homely setting. Some rooms feature spacious living areas, offering additional comfort for longer stays. Although the hotel does not offer air-conditioning, the cool breezes from the Elbe ensure a pleasant atmosphere throughout the year. Guests are treated to free amenities, including convenient parking and a continental breakfast buffet, served in a charming dining room with stunning river views. When it comes to exploring the area, guests have a wide variety of activities to choose from. A leisurely walk to the Beach Grimmershörn Bay takes only 2 minutes, where guests can enjoy the tranquil waters and the natural beauty of the coast. Those interested in history can visit the nearby Alte Liebe, a historic wooden pier and vantage point, or explore the famous Kugelbake, a towering wooden beacon that marks the meeting point of the North Sea and the Elbe. Cuxhaven is known for its maritime heritage, and there are plenty of opportunities to engage with the local culture. The hotel’s proximity to public transport makes it easy to reach major airports, such as Hamburg and Bremen, both within a reasonable travel distance by taxi or public transit. For dining options, guests can indulge in a variety of cuisines from nearby restaurants. Sturmflut Bierlokal, just 4 minutes away by taxi, offers a great selection of local brews, while Seeterrassen Restaurant & Café, a mere 3 minutes away, serves up traditional German dishes. Those craving Italian fare can visit Ristorante Fontana di Trevi, just 1 minute away, for authentic pasta and pizza. After a long search for a nice hotel we ended up here. Even though we were quite proud of the price, the reviews convinced us. When we arrived the welcome was OK but nothing more. The room was small but met our expectations and was very clean. The hard mattresses didn't cause us any problems either. Unfortunately, the shower didn't flow well and we were standing in the soup after showering for 2 minutes. It also happened that there was no hot water in the evening. So showering wasn't really possible. The welcome at the first breakfast was really bad. We come into the breakfast room and both hotel owners were there. After a minute, nothing came. Other guests then explained everything to us. We didn't like the breakfast at all, which was touted in the reviews. The rolls were really bad and the cheese and cold cuts weren't our thing either. It looked like mass-produced goods to us. The tables were usually already set with breakfast foods. It even gave us the impression (subjectively) that unused food from the table was being used again for the next one. Even if the price for breakfast is really low, a little more quality and friendliness wouldn't be bad. The mood in the room spoke for itself, and at the neighboring table the owners were blaming each other. We didn't feel welcome at all and can't recommend this hotel.

Very nice hotel in a good location. Very courteous service from the owners and special requests for breakfast were taken into account without being asked (low carb, no bread, but vegetables, etc.). The beds are very comfortable and the rooms are fine. It's not all that new, but it's absolutely fine. The room doors are a bit noisy, but this wasn't a problem due to the floor plan. The bathroom could have been a little larger, but that is of course due to the age of the house (over 100 years) and is therefore absolutely fine.
